Bis forBlanket

The girl in the picture is lying in bed under a blanket. Blankets are big, thick, warm pieces of cloth that you usually have on your bed. Many people knit or crochet blankets.

Bis forBlare

Something blares if it makes a continuous, loud, and somewhat unpleasant noise. For example, "the loudspeaker was blaring music all day".

Bis forBlaze

A blaze is either a brightly burning fire, or the white mark down the middle of a horse's face.

Bis forBleach

Bleach is a chemical that removes colors, or the process of removing colors. It is often used when washing stained white linen, like sheets and tablecloths. People sometimes bleach their hair to a lighter color. Things will often bleach naturally from the action of sunlight, without chemical help, such as these bleached shells on the beach.

Bis forBleak

A place is bleak if it is bare, desolate and windswept. Your mood or outlook is bleak if it is without hope or depressing.

Bis forBleat

Bleating is the noise sheep make. People also say that sheep go baa or maa.

Bis forBled

Bled is the past tense of bleed, for example "our dog bled on the carpet".

Bis forBleed

You bleed when you lose blood from where it is supposed to be. When you cut yourself, you bleed. A bruise forms when you bleed inside, and the blood makes a dark patch under your skin.

Bis forBlend

You blend things together when you mix them so well you cannot tell what went into making the blend. The picture is of a blender full of fruit, ready to make a fruit smoothie.
